Trust becomes difficult after disappointment, betrayal, or prolonged waiting. Psalm 28:7 says your heart trusts in the Lord, and He helps you. That help includes protection for your heart when it feels bruised or hesitant. God does not ignore wounded trust. He shields your heart while healing it, preventing further harm while restoring confidence and hope.
Hannah carried deep pain that could have hardened her heart. Instead, she poured her grief before God. In that vulnerable place, God shielded her heart from despair and met her with help. Her trust was not instant, but it was intentional. God protected her emotions while rebuilding her hope. A guarded heart does not mean a closed heart. It means a heart held safely while trust grows again.
Today, allow God to shield your heart without shutting it down. Trust may feel fragile, but protection makes it possible to trust again. God stands close to your wounded places, guarding them with care, patience, and strength. As you lean into His help, your heart will learn that safety and trust can exist together under divine covering.
